Output 08d565eedaacd103b677b776cebdd6a2a41f62d4815f6f34d1dcd1960c66d45f:12

value
583408
script pubkey
OP_0 OP_PUSHBYTES_32 0391689faa9d76da697af9e235d8e9ac3130050a0077777c02287ed1732a4dc3
address
bc1qqwgk38a2n4md56t6l83rtk8f4scnqpg2qpmhwlqz9pldzue2fhpsjtawja
transaction
08d565eedaacd103b677b776cebdd6a2a41f62d4815f6f34d1dcd1960c66d45f
spent
true